We made out the commandments "do not steal," "do not make yourself an idol," "do not kill." In general, all the ten commandments given to Moses by God himself. Recall again what they say:

  1. "I am the Lord thy God." Man should not have other Gods, except our Creator.

  2. Do not make yourself an idol. Idol alone, He can do anything. People should not look for an idol among people.

  3. Do not take the name of your Lord in vain.

  4. Work six days, give the seventh to God.

  5. Honor your parents.

  6. Dont kill.

  7. Do not commit adultery. That is, do not enter into the sin of fornication.

  8. Do not steal.

  9. Do not give false testimony against your neighbor.

  10. Do not desire anything that your neighbor has.

What is the commandment "do not steal"? She is one of the most famous even in the modern world. We remind you that she is the eighth in a row.
